ABSTRACT:
A female connector (30) comprises an elongated housing (32) and two separate blades (34, 36). The housing (32) includes one power region (40) and one signal region (50) spaced from each other by a space (90) therebetween. The power region (40) includes a plurality of first passageways (42) for receiving a corresponding number of first contact (60) therein. The signal region (50) includes a plurality of second passageways (52) for receiving a corresponding number of second contacts (70) therein. The opening (41) of the passageway (42) has an expanded curved contour (48) on two sides for allowance of lateral deviation of an inserted male contact, and the first contacts (60) includes a pair of arms (66) arranged to face each other in a vertical direction for being adapted to receive the deviated inserted male contact of a complementary connector (14).
